The integration of insurance requirements within home automation and energy management domains emphasizes the necessity for robust, technologically sophisticated solutions. Modern insurance models increasingly leverage IoT connectivity, enabling continuous, real-time monitoring of residential energy consumption, security systems, and environmental parameters. These advancements facilitate detailed risk assessment, dynamic policy adjustments, and proactive loss prevention strategies. Engineering principles underpinning smart home technologies—such as sensor networks, data encryption, and secure communication protocols—enhance system reliability and data integrity, critical for insurance evaluations. Industry applications include automated fault detection, real-time incident reporting, and predictive maintenance, which collectively minimize hazards and optimize safety outcomes. Innovations like machine learning algorithms and big data analytics enable insurers to analyze vast datasets, identifying patterns that inform risk mitigation and policy pricing. In securing dwellings, smart security solutions—integrated with energy management systems—offer improved asset protection and fraud prevention.
